From 4e40b035c8337cddcf4f94fcd83a2f0d454488b6 Mon Sep 17 00:00:00 2001 From: David Euresti Date: Fri, 27 Jul 2018 13:28:43 -0700 Subject: [PATCH] BaseException does not take keyword arguments (#2348) Fixes #2344 --- stdlib/2/__builtin__.pyi | 2 +- stdlib/2/builtins.pyi | 2 +- stdlib/3/builtins.pyi |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/stdlib/2/__builtin__.pyi b/stdlib/2/__builtin__.pyi index a1d1e49ae..2e9ea8591 100644 --- a/stdlib/2/__builtin__.pyi +++ b/stdlib/2/__builtin__.pyi @@ -966,7 +966,7 @@ class memoryview(Sized, Container[bytes]): class BaseException(object): args = ... # type: Tuple[Any, ...] message = ... # type: Any - def __init__(self, *args: object, **kwargs: object) -> None: ... + def __init__(self, *args: object) -> None: ... def __getitem__(self, i: int) -> Any: ... def __getslice__(self, start: int, stop: int) -> Tuple[Any, ...]: ... diff --git a/stdlib/2/builtins.pyi b/stdlib/2/builtins.pyi index a1d1e49ae..2e9ea8591 100644 --- a/stdlib/2/builtins.pyi +++ b/stdlib/2/builtins.pyi @@ -966,7 +966,7 @@ class memoryview(Sized, Container[bytes]): class BaseException(object): args = ... # type: Tuple[Any, ...] message = ... # type: Any - def __init__(self, *args: object, **kwargs: object) -> None: ... + def __init__(self, *args: object) -> None: ... def __getitem__(self, i: int) -> Any: ... def __getslice__(self, start: int, stop: int) -> Tuple[Any, ...]: ... diff --git a/stdlib/3/builtins.pyi b/stdlib/3/builtins.pyi index cf2a8cdb1..78c598592 100644 --- a/stdlib/3/builtins.pyi +++ b/stdlib/3/builtins.pyi @@ -942,7 +942,7 @@ class BaseException: __cause__ = ... # type: Optional[BaseException] __context__ = ... # type: Optional[BaseException] __traceback__ = ... # type: Optional[TracebackType] - def __init__(self, *args: object, **kwargs: object) -> None: ... + def __init__(self, *args: object) -> None: ... def with_traceback(self, tb: Optional[TracebackType]) -> BaseException: ... class GeneratorExit(BaseException): ...